About the role

The Afterschool Counselor leads engaging activities for children ages 4-12, including STEM projects, arts and crafts, and outdoor play. They are responsible for ensuring the safety and well-being of students while fostering social-emotional growth and maintaining program operations.

Why Your Role Matters

This is a seasonal, part-time position that follows the academic school year, beginning in August and continuing through May/June. The role offers weekday afternoon shifts from 2:00 PM -- 6:30 PM at elementary schools in Kyle/Buda areas. Enjoy weekends off and a free YMCA membership!

As an Afterschool Youth Development Leader, you'll create a safe, engaging, and supportive environment for children ages 4--12. You'll lead activities that foster social-emotional growth, support academic success, and make afternoons fun and enriching. Most importantly, you'll help students feel seen, supported, and excited to learn and grow.

How You Will Make an Impact

Lead and engage youth in a variety of activities, including games, arts and crafts, STEM projects, outdoor play, and academic support, that promote learning, creativity, teamwork, and personal growth.

Supervise groups of children throughout the program day, ensuring their safety, well-being, and positive participation while adhering to YMCA policies and Texas Childcare licensing standards.

Foster social-emotional development by modeling positive behavior and the YMCA's core values of caring, honesty, respect, and responsibility.

Create and maintain a safe, inclusive, and welcoming environment where all participants feel valued, supported, and encouraged to succeed.

Follow established curriculum and lesson plans while adapting activities to meet the needs and interests of participants.

Communicate effectively with children, families, and staff, providing updates, addressing concerns, and building positive relationships.

Serve and supervise snack time while maintaining sanitation, health, and safety standards.

Manage program operations through attendance tracking, activity preparation, documentation, organization, and other administrative responsibilities.

Participate in staff meetings, trainings, and professional development opportunities to enhance program quality and effectiveness.

Serve as a positive ambassador of the YMCA's mission, vision, and values, contributing to a strong and supportive community.

Complete other duties as assigned.
